Quote:
Originally Posted by Jttsaz
I'm stuck! Is there some sort of trick to get past the part where you have to stay and defend the Mexican President in the face of an all out onslaught..even if I manage to stay alive the Prez is killed...someone help me please...

If it is the part I am thinking of just take cover in the parking garage and take out the guys that come up the ramps from two different directions.

Once that part is past go up to the roof so you can access the ammo box and get the rocket launcher to take out the APC.

I assume you are talking about the 360 version not the regular XBOX version. They are different.
